400
阿里云
列出设备的权限__接口列表_服务器端API_阿里云物联网套件-阿里云
列出设备权限
描述
请求参数
| 名称 | 类型 | 是否必须 | 描述 |
|---|---|---|---|
| <公共参数> | 见 公共参数 | ||
| ProductKey | Long | 是 | 设备的ProductKey |
| DeviceName | String | 是 | 设备名称 |
返回参数
| 名称 | 类型 | 描述 |
|---|---|---|
| Success | Boolean | 表示调用成功与否 |
| RequestId | String | 当前请求在阿里云产生的请求ID |
| ErrorMessage | String | 出错信息 |
| DevicePermissions | List | 权限列表 |
DevicePermissions定义:
| 名称 | 类型 | 描述 |
|---|---|---|
| Id | Long | 权限的id |
| GrantType | String | PUB,SUB,ALL |
| TopicFullName | String | topic全名,如:/ProductKey/xxx |
示例
- 请求示例
https://iot.aliyuncs.com/?&Action=ListDevicePermits&ProductKey=...&DeviceName=...&<[公共请求参数]>
SDK示例代码 [SDK下载]
- java
ListDevicePermitsRequest listDevicePermitsRequest = new ListDevicePermitsRequest();listDevicePermitsRequest.setDeviceName("...");listDevicePermitsRequest.setProductKey(...);ListDevicePermitsResponse devicePermitsResponse = client.getAcsResponse(listDevicePermitsRequest);List<ListDevicePermitsResponse.DevicePermission> devicePermissions = devicePermitsResponse.getDevicePermissions();for (ListDevicePermitsResponse.DevicePermission devicePermission : devicePermissions) {System.out.println(devicePermission.getTopicFullName() + ":" + devicePermission.getGrantType() + ":"+ devicePermission.getTopicUserId() + ",ID:" + devicePermission.getId());}
php
python
request = ListDevicePermitsRequest.ListDevicePermitsRequest()request.set_accept_format('json') // 设置返回数据格式,默认为XMLrequest.set_ProductKey('...')request.set_DeviceName('...')result = clt.do_action(request)print 'list device permits : ' + result
- java
返回示例
json示例
{"RequestId":"120F5EB3-7023-4F0C-B419-9303AB336885","Success":true"devicePermissions":[...]}
XML示例
<ListDevicePermitsResponse><RequestId>82285BAF-640C-4EC2-9264-B96A27688AB7</RequestId><Success>true</Success><devicePermissions>...</devicePermissions></ListDevicePermitsResponse>
最后更新:2016-12-08 14:06:04
上一篇:
根据设备名称查询设备信息__接口列表_服务器端API_阿里云物联网套件-阿里云
下一篇:
批量获取设备状态__接口列表_服务器端API_阿里云物联网套件-阿里云
作业浏览__Intelij 开发插件_工具_大数据计算服务-阿里云
专属账号申请流程?__充值介绍_账户资产_财务-阿里云
调用服务__使用说明_用户手册_云服务总线 CSB-阿里云
AddVServerGroupBackendServers__VServerGroup相关API_API 参考_负载均衡-阿里云
禁止直播流推送__直播流操作接口_API 手册_CDN-阿里云
冷却时间__使用须知_用户指南_弹性伸缩-阿里云
云盾高防IP计费方式___购买指导_DDoS 高防IP-阿里云
集群的生命周期__集群管理_用户指南_容器服务-阿里云
SLB快速开始__负载均衡 体验_体验馆-阿里云
负载均衡支持UDP协议常见问题__常见问题_负载均衡-阿里云
相关内容
常见错误说明__附录_大数据计算服务-阿里云
发送短信接口__API使用手册_短信服务-阿里云
接口文档__Android_安全组件教程_移动安全-阿里云
运营商错误码(联通)__常见问题_短信服务-阿里云
设置短信模板__使用手册_短信服务-阿里云
OSS 权限问题及排查__常见错误及排除_最佳实践_对象存储 OSS-阿里云
消息通知__操作指南_批量计算-阿里云
设备端快速接入(MQTT)__快速开始_阿里云物联网套件-阿里云
查询API调用流量数据__API管理相关接口_API_API 网关-阿里云
使用STS访问__JavaScript-SDK_SDK 参考_对象存储 OSS-阿里云